原文:ActivityManagerService數據結構ProcessRecord(一)

Android系統中用於描述進程的數據結構是ProcessRecord對象,AMS便是管理進程的核心模塊。四大組件 Activity,Service, BroadcastReceiver, ContentProvider 定義在AndroidManifest.xml文件, 每一項都可以用屬性android:process指定所運行的進程。同一個app可以運行在通過一個進程,也可以運行在多個進程, ...

2019-03-21 20:47 0 819 推薦指數:

查看詳情

ActivityManagerService數據結構Activity棧管理(二)

ActivityManagerService要管理四大組件,那四大組件就必須在AMS中有存在的形式,這里先從AMS 如何管理Activity 談起; Activity在AMS 中存在的形式為ActivityRecord; AMS以Task的方式管理 ...

Fri Mar 22 04:46:00 CST 2019 0 898
數據結構結構

某末流學校計算機學院和網絡空間安全學院數據結構作業 Buchiyexiao 作業一 Fibonacci數列 子集全集輸出 作業二 作業二代碼在檢查完之后整理過程中不小心刪除了,然后清了回收站,不過作業二是針對鏈表的題目,並不難 作業三 Transpose方法對於三角矩陣 ...

Thu Jul 22 00:55:00 CST 2021 0 139
什么是數據結構,為什么我們需要數據結構

來源: https://blog.fundebug.com/2018/08/27/code-interview-data-structure/ 什么是數據結構數據結構是計算機存儲、組織數據的方式。對於特定的數據結構(比如數組),有些操作效率很高(讀某個數組元素),有些操作的效率很低(刪除 ...

Mon Oct 29 00:44:00 CST 2018 0 1017
數據結構--樹形結構

數據結構--樹形結構 今天在博客上看到這樣一段代碼,感覺挺有意思,代碼如下: 我想到了樹形結構,但還是有爭議,有人說它是鄰接鏈表,不知大家怎么看?總之還是先回顧下樹形吧。 樹形 ...

Mon Feb 26 05:52:00 CST 2018 0 1048
數據結構-線性結構

線性表 線性表是最簡單最常見的數據結構,屬於邏輯結構; 線性表有兩種實現方式(存儲方式),分別是順序實現和鏈接實現; 定義: 線性表是由n(>=0)個數據元素組成的有限序列,數據元素的個數n定義為表的長度; 術語: 前驅, 后繼, 直接前驅, 直接后繼, 長度, 空表 ...

Sat Feb 22 00:32:00 CST 2020 0 1418
數據結構詳解

前言:平時我們敲代碼都會涉及到數據結構,但是真正深入數據結構的時候,又有一種模糊感,下面讓我們來詳細理解下。 說到數據結構,我們都會談到線性結構和非線性結構。 1.線性結構:是一個有序數據元素的集合。它應該滿足下面的特征: 集合中必存在唯一的一個“第一個元素” 集合中必存在唯一 ...

Wed Apr 24 20:29:00 CST 2019 0 866
數據結構筆記

本篇內容是根據B站郝斌數據結構的學習筆記,本篇筆記是用markdown根據Typora編寫,copy到博客有些格式微調,如發現錯誤望留言指正,不勝感激! 如有侵權請聯系我刪除:473462132@qq.com 如想轉載請注明出處謝謝! ps:本篇篇幅較長,請慢慢享用 ...

Thu Apr 25 23:18:00 CST 2019 1 15169
數據結構

數據結構 哈希表、樹狀數組、線段樹...... 由於這些知識點較為基礎,相信各位神仙都會,因此不再贅述(斜眼笑) 可持久化數據結抅之主席樹 就是可持久化權值線段樹 利用前綴和思想,每個位置的那棵樹比前一個位置的那棵樹多一個值 那么每次查詢在兩棵線段樹上二分即可 P3834 【模板 ...

Mon Jul 19 21:49:00 CST 2021 0 126
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M